McCullough Robertson advised ASX-listed Rural Funds Group on its acquisition and lease of Cobungra Station, one of Victoria’s largest beef breeding enterprises.
Rural Funds Group is a real estate investment trust, with assets worth $836.7 million. The $35 million purchase raises the investment trust’s portfolio value of cattle stations to over $250 million.
We also advised the trust with respect to corporate and regulatory compliance advice concerning this transaction, and are proud to act as Rural Funds’ trusted legal adviser.
The 6486-hectare alpine beef property has been leased to Wagyu producer, Stone Axe Pastoral Company. The agreement is on a 19-year lease with a rent review in year five.
